Baseball Preview: Glendale Prep Academy Griffins vs. Veritas Prep Falcons
The Glendale Prep Academy Griffins will face off against the Veritas Prep Falcons at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. Both come into the match b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Glendale Prep Academy is looking to give their home crowd another W after opening their season at home on Friday. Their pitchers stepped up to hand Tempe Prep a 15-0 shutout.
Logan Middendorf was a major factor no matter where he played. On the mound, he struck out six batters over three innings while giving up no earned runs off one hit (and not a single walk). Middendorf was also stellar in the batter's box, going a perfect 3-for-3 with one home run, five RBI, and two runs. The dominant performance gave him a new career-high in RBI.

In other batting news, Corbin Kim and Alex Rodriguez did most of the damage at the plate: Kim scored two runs while going 2-for-3, while Rodriguez scored three runs and stole a base while going 2-for-2. The dominant performance also gave Rodriguez a new career-high in hits (two). Another player making a difference was Joshua Rickey, who scored two runs while getting on base in two of his three plate appearances.
Meanwhile, Veritas Prep had to travel to play their first game of the season, but the final result was worth the trip. They had just enough and edged out Gilbert Classical Academy 1-0 on Thursday.
Veritas Prep's victory was truly a team effort as four different players contributed at least one hit. One of them was Logan Cortes, who went 1-for-2 with one triple and one RBI.
Glendale Prep Academy couldn't quite finish off Veritas Prep in their previous matchup back in March of 2024 and fell 4-2. Can Glendale Prep Academy av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
